In a heartfelt interview with Monopoly Events in early March 2026, AEW star Billy Gunn opened up about his deep and ongoing friendship with former WWE writer and on-screen partner Road Dogg (Brian James), declaring him his “favorite wrestler of all time” not just for their legendary tag team run, but for the genuine bond that has endured long after the spotlight faded.

Gunn, now 62 and still active in AEW alongside The Acclaimed and other talents, shared that the real connection with Road Dogg goes far beyond their in-ring success as The New Age Outlaws or their time in D-Generation X. “He is my favorite of all time because he was part of one of the best times in wrestling and he is my true partner because I talk to him all the time and it’s just to say, ‘hello’ and that you can’t beat,” Gunn said. “I talk to him all the time… it’s just to say hello, and that you can’t beat.”

The pair’s relationship has remained strong despite Road Dogg’s shift from performer to a key backstage role as a WWE writer and producer (a position he held until his departure from the company in late 2025). Gunn credits the constant, low-key communication—simple check-ins and hellos—as the foundation of their enduring friendship.

Fans have long speculated about a potential on-screen reunion, especially after Road Dogg’s WWE exit. The two did briefly reunite as The New Age Outlaws for an independent appearance at Great Lakes Championship Wrestling’s Blizzard Brawl event in Milwaukee in December 2025, proving their chemistry still captivates crowds.

Road Dogg has previously mentioned in interviews that he and Gunn weren’t initially close friends or roommates during their peak tag team years, citing early personality clashes. However, time clearly turned that dynamic into a true brotherhood, with Gunn’s recent comments underscoring mutual respect and loyalty.

The revelation comes at a time when cross-promotional shoutouts between WWE and AEW talents are rare, making Gunn’s praise stand out as a feel-good moment in wrestling. Road Dogg has not publicly responded yet, but their history suggests the sentiment is shared.

For fans, Gunn’s words are a reminder of how wrestling can forge lifelong bonds that outlast championships and storylines. The New Age Outlaws remain one of the Attitude Era’s most iconic tag teams, inducted into the WWE Hall of Fame in 2019 as part of D-Generation X.
